Products - GPCH8001B (OTP)



GPCH8001B (OTP) Copy Link.


Working Voltage (V)Max.CPU Speed (MHz)ROM TypeBuilt-in ROM (Byte)RAM (Byte)I/OAudio Output (DAC)H/W MIDI Channel (SPU)CPU CLK OSC. ROSCCPU CLK OSC. X'TALWDTLVRADCSPISIOHigh Sink Current I/O
2.4~5.57.159ROMLESS/OTP512K5123212 bit x 2 Channel8VVVVVVV4 bit



General Description


The GPCH8001B embedded with an 8-bit processor, 512K bytes OTP ROM (or External 4M bytes maximal program ROM), 512 bytes working SRAM, 3 sets of 12-bit timer, 32 general I/Os, 1 set of 12-bit ADC with 4 channels input and 2 sets of 12-bit DAC. The microprocessor can implement software based on audio processing, functional control and others. For audio processing, melody and speech can be mixed into one output. The GPCH8001B is implemented with a high performance SPU voice engine to achieve 8-channel voice with ADPCM/PCM data. It operates over a wide voltage range from 2.2V through 5.5V, and it includes a Low Voltage Reset to assure system operating appropriately under low voltage condition. In addition, GPCH8001B provides sleep mode for power savings. It can be awakened from sleep mode by interrupt sources or by IOA's state change. There is a Serial Peripheral Interface (SPI) controller built in GPCH8001B to facilitate communicating with other devices and components. Also a SIO (Serial interface I/O) controller is featured which offers a one-bit serial interface to communicate with other devices.


Features

  • Working Voltage: 2.4V - 5.5V
  • CPU Speed: 7.159MHz.
  • FOSC = 14.318MHz (2 x CPU clock)
  • ROM Size: 512K bytes OTP ROM (or can connect External ROM Max. 4M bytes)
  • RAM Size: 512 bytes (Programmable RAM 384 bytes)
  • Three 12-bit timers/counters, TMA/TMB/TMC (Programmable and Auto Reload)
  • Sleep mode to reduce power
  • Key change wake-up function
  • 13 IRQs & 7 NMI Interrupts
  • Watchdog Function
  • Low Voltage Reset: 2.2V
  • 32 general I/Os, including 8 general/special I/Os (Bit Programmable)
  • 4-bit I/O with high sink current(20mA) for LED application
  • IOA with 1M pull low function to prevent current leakage from error key touch
  • Two 12-bit DAC outputs (D/A output: 4mA/channel)
  • SPU(Sound Processing Unit) engine can output audio data of 15-bit resolution with 12-bit DAC to perform high quality sound
  • IR PWM Output
  • 8-channel SPU engine with ADPCM/PCM wave table
  • Generalplus ICE_CORE embedded, new Application can be developed using SunMidiarR Development tools
  • Tone color (Speech) with ADPCM algorithm to save memory usage
  • 4-channel input of 12 bit ADC
  • One Generalplus Serial I/O interface
  • One SPI serial I/O interface

Data Sheet

GPCH8001BV11_ds.pdf   Copy Link.

Application / Engineering Note

AN0048-GPCH4-8 Driver-16.pdf   Copy Link. AN0129-32768_Crystal_Oscillation_Application_Note-16.pdf
Please input the answer before download.